6B6L
The crystal structure of glycosyl hydrolase family 2 (GH2) member from Bacteroides cellulosilyticus DSM 14838
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| APS BEAMLINE 19-ID |
| Synchrotron site | APS |
| Beamline | 19-ID |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2015-07-07 |
| Detector | ADSC QUANTUM 315r |
| Wavelength(s) | 0.97929 |
| Spacegroup name | P 1 21 1 |
| Unit cell lengths | 57.528, 227.135, 66.902 |
| Unit cell angles | 90.00, 108.83, 90.00 |
